The following summary may help you to understand the differences between markdown language and HTML. The Azure DevOps Wiki uses markdown language, which was was created in 2004 by John Gruber in collaboration with Aaron Swartz, and it has been used in GitHub and Azure DevOps. The goal was to keep it easy to write and read, and there is some syntax that emulates the most common HTML tags. Although it is a repo, it is hidden from view, which means that you cannot access it through repos or even project settings. The AWS Toolkit for Azure DevOps is an extension for hosted and on-premises Microsoft Azure DevOps that make it easy to manage and deploy applications using AWS. In the new blade, select the repository, the branch, the folder (by default, the README.md is on the root), and define a Wiki name (we are going to use the current repo name added by the suffix -Wiki). A simple visual aid that will help you to memorize is that the first page always has a Home icon associated with it. After choosing a Code Wiki, all the files with .md extension will be listed, click on them, and the content will be displayed on the right side.
